Patio post repair services involve restoring and strengthening the support structures that hold up outdoor patios, decks, and porches. Over time, exposure to weather elements like snow, rain, and temperature fluctuations can cause wooden or metal posts to weaken, crack, or rot. Repair work typically includes replacing damaged posts, reinforcing existing supports, and ensuring the entire structure is stable and secure. This service helps maintain the safety and functionality of outdoor living spaces, preventing potential accidents caused by compromised supports.
Many common problems lead homeowners to seek patio post repair services. These include posts that have shifted or leaning due to soil movement, rotting wood caused by moisture exposure, or rust and corrosion in metal supports. In some cases, posts may develop cracks or splits that compromise their load-bearing capacity.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ent more extensive damage to the entire patio or deck structure, saving money and preserving the outdoor space’s safety and appearance.

Homeowners should consider patio post repair services when they notice signs of structural weakness or damage. Common indicators include leaning or wobbling posts, visible rotting or rust, cracked or split wood, or gaps between posts and the supporting beams. If a deck or porch feels unstable or shows signs of shifting, it’s a clear sign that repairs are needed. The overview below groups typical Patio Post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Boulder, CO.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Many routine patio post repairs in Boulder and nearby areas typically cost between $250 and $600. These projects often involve replacing damaged or rotted posts and are common for homeowners maintaining their existing patios. Most repairs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ching higher costs.
Moderate Fixes - For more extensive repairs such as replacing multiple posts or addressing foundational issues, local contractors generally charge between $600 and $1,500. These projects may include some reinforcement work and tend to be more complex, leading to higher costs for larger jobs.
Full Post Replacement - Complete replacement of all patio posts in a standard-sized area can range from $1,500 to $3,500 depending on materials and scope. Many projects in this category are straightforward but can vary based on accessibility and post type used.
Full Patio Post Replacement - Larger, more involved projects, such as replacing posts for an entire patio or deck, can reach $4,000 or more. These tend to be less common but involve significant labor and materials, leading to higher overall costs for complex or custom installations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of damage can lead to patio post repairs? Common issues include rotting wood, rusted metal, cracked or leaning posts, and damage caused by weather or pests that compromise the stability of patio supports.
How do local contractors typically repair damaged patio posts? They may replace entire posts, reinforce existing structures, or apply weatherproofing treatments to extend the lifespan of the posts and restore stability.
What signs indicate that patio posts need repair? Visible signs include leaning or wobbling posts, cracked or splintered wood, rusted metal components, or sagging sections of the patio structure.
Are there different repair options depending on the material of the patio posts? Yes, repair methods vary for wood, metal, or composite posts, with options including replacement, reinforcement, or sealing to prevent further damage.
